About Newtown 4350

The size of Newtown is approximately 5.5 square kilometres. It has 15 parks covering nearly 15.4% of total area. The population of Newtown in 2016 was 9596 people. By 2021 the population was 10039 showing a population growth of 4.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Newtown is 20-29 years. Households in Newtown are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Newtown work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 50.30% of the homes in Newtown were owner-occupied compared with 52.30% in 2016.

Newtown has 5,400 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Newtown have seen a 126.15%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 112.76% increase. As at 30 November 2025:

  • The median value for Houses in Newtown is $696,896 while the median value for Units is $553,623.
  • Houses have a median rent of $520 while Units have a median rent of $445.
There are currently 32 properties listed for sale, and 24 properties listed for rent in Newtown on OnTheHouse. According to Cotality's data, 288 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Newtown.
